Retail Jobs in Austin That Don't Require a Degree
Retail sells goods directly to consumers in stores or online. Retail associates assist customers and manage inventory. Customer service and communication skills are key.
Here are 1,662 Retail jobs that are in high demand and usually don't need a college degree. Salaries in Austin can pay up to $16.58 per hour. Right now, Retail Sales Associate, Cashier, and Store Manager have the most job openings.

Retail Sales Associate
Review job description
Please refer to the employers job description for complete details.
Retail Sales Associates assist customers, manage inventory, and drive sales. Success requires product knowledge, effective communication, and customer service excellence.
31% of Retail Sales Associate openings in Austin don't require a degree. Retail Sales Associate jobs take 41 days on average from job posting to starting date. Currently, 54% of job openings are part-time roles.
